17 Results Terms consent and assent are interpreted differently in legal texts between EEA countries In EEA countries, 18 years generally the legal age for independent consent - exceptions; 14 Austria, 15 Finland and Denmark, 16 UK 32 different age groupings ( )! 3 countries (Croatia, Lithuania and Slovakia) without spesific age groups for consent / assent Different definitions for legal consent and the requirement of legal signatures; criteria are not uniformly defined in European guidelines or recommendations (unknown reasons) 17

19 WG4-Task 3:Uniform IC / Assent template (2017) Background facts: 1. New EU CT Reg. (impl.approx.10/2018) will harmonise clinical trial application (CTA) process, but IC/Assent issues remain with each Member State 2. There are noticeable differences between national IC and assent requirements in Europe due to national laws and regulations (See: Tool Kit data) These discrepancies present challenges for multicentre paediatric CTs 19
20 WG4 - Task 3: Uniform IC/ Assent template 3. Deliverable: Partly harmonized of Informed Consent / Assent template -document : Consent group o Based on identification of all similar elements across assents / consents of existing templates o 1. version published on Enpr-EMA Annual Workshop, 16 May

28 FINPEDMED: Picture Cards (2008) Designed by a group of experts and a graphic designer Children (ages 1 to 6) commented -> modified to better suit the objects Labelled in Finnish, Swedish and English. The picture cards are under copyright law 2009 Exist in printed form sized A6, in a folder sized A5 31 picture cards, abstracts and transparent No-card PL 28
